Understanding Key Features When Buying Tech
Shopping for a tech gift can feel like deciphering a secret code. You're hit with a wall of specs, jargon, and marketing hype. To get it right, you need to cut through the noise and focus on what actually makes a gadget great. This isn't about buying the most expensive thing; it's about finding something that truly fits into their life.
The absolute first thing to check is compatibility. Think of it like a puzzle piece—it doesn't matter how cool it looks if it doesn't fit. The biggest divide in the tech world is between Apple's iOS and Google's Android. An Apple Watch is a brilliant gift for an iPhone owner, but it’s basically a paperweight for someone with an Android phone. Always, always check what operating system they use before buying anything that connects to their phone, like a smartwatch or wireless earbuds.
Digging Deeper Than the Label
Once you've nailed compatibility, it's time to look at the details that define the day-to-day experience. Two of the most important factors that separate a good gadget from a great one are battery life and build quality. These are the things they'll notice every single day.
Here's what to look for on the spec sheet:
- Battery Life: Never take "all-day battery" at face value. Look for concrete numbers. You'll either see the capacity listed in milliamp-hours (mAh) or a specific usage estimate, like 10 hours of video playback. This gives you a much clearer picture of how long it will actually last.
- Build Quality: Pay close attention to the materials. A device made with aluminum or Gorilla Glass is going to stand up to daily life far better than something made of cheap plastic. This is especially crucial for things that get carried around and handled a lot, like headphones or a portable speaker.
A gift with great build quality and long battery life is a gift that gets used, not one that sits in a drawer. These practical features are what turn a novelty into a reliable part of someone's daily routine.

The Latest Model vs. Last Year's Bargain
This is a classic dilemma: do you spring for the brand-new release or save some cash on a slightly older version? It really depends on the type of tech. For something like a smartphone, where the cameras and processors get a major boost each year, the latest model is often worth the extra spend.
But for other gadgets, the updates are more gradual. Think about smart speakers or e-readers. A model from last year often delivers 95% of the performance for a much friendlier price.
The best way to decide is to do a quick search for "new features" on the latest model. If those updates don't seem like something your gift recipient would use, grabbing the older version is almost always the smarter financial move.
And finally, the big one: what if you’re not sure about compatibility? If you have any doubt, stick to gifts that work with almost anything. Gadgets that connect via Bluetooth or use a standard USB-C cable—like a great pair of headphones or a portable power bank—are usually a safe bet.
If you’re eyeing something specific to an ecosystem, like an Apple Watch, you really need to know if they use an iPhone. If you can’t ask them directly, just make sure you buy from a store with a generous and easy return policy. It’s the ultimate safety net.
